Marigold Market organizes the golden yellow-orange spectrum around one of the most important flower colors in global design — the marigold, which carries cultural significance across South Asian, Latin American, and Mediterranean traditions and is among the most commercially important cut flowers in global markets. The five core values move from deep ochre through amber, saffron, and peak marigold to pale gold, while Terracotta provides the warm red-orange complement that appears naturally in dried flower markets and autumn harvest contexts.

In consumer product design, the combination of Saffron, Marigold, and Pale Gold is one of the strongest performing warm-spectrum systems in food, beverage, and fragrance packaging. Gold and amber tones carry consistent associations with quality, warmth, and premium positioning in global consumer research. The specific tone of Marigold — bright and warm without tipping into the pure yellow that can read as caution or cheapness — is particularly valuable for premium-tier product branding.

For festive and seasonal design, Marigold Market works across multiple cultural celebrations — it maps directly to Diwali's golden palette, to Día de los Muertos flower decoration, to harvest festivals across European traditions, and to the warm-toned aesthetics of autumn in general. This cross-cultural versatility is unusual for a palette so specifically named; the marigold's role in disparate celebrations gives this golden palette unusual breadth of seasonal application.

Terracotta's role in this palette is that of the ground — in traditional South Asian and Mediterranean building materials, the fired terracotta of pots and roof tiles pairs constantly with the yellow-gold of flowers and textiles. Including it here activates this deep visual association, adding a grounded warmth and natural quality to what would otherwise be a purely floral palette.
